1111pertemuan 7
1111pertemuan 7
Pertemuan 7
2. Menurut (Fathansyah, 2012), ERD adalah model entity relationship yang berisi
adalah bentuk paling awal dalam melakukan perancangan basis data relasional.
B. Komponen ERD
1. Entitas
Entitas adalah suatu kumpulan object atau sesuatu yang dapat dibedakan atau
dapat diidentifikasikan secara unik. Dan kumpulan entitas yang sejenis disebut
Yaitu entity set yang satu atau lebih atributnya digunakan oleh entity set lain
sebuah entity set dengan atribute-atribute a1, a2,..,an, maka entity set
Yaitu Entity set yang bergantung terhadap strong entity set. Digambarkan
dengan empat persegi panjang bertumpuk. Misal : A adalah weak entity set
54
c)
dari atribute-atribute a1, a2, .., ar dan B adalah strong entity set dengan
Contoh :
2. Atribut
Jenis-jenis atribut :
a) Atribut Kunci
unik.
b) Atribut Simple
entity.
Contoh : Pada gambar dibawah ini, yang menjadi atribut key adalah
NIP. Tgl Lahir dan Nama adalah atribut simple. Sedangkan Gelar
55
Merupakan suatu atribut yang terdiri dari beberapa atribut yang lebih kecil
yang terdiri dari nama depan, nama tengah dan nama belakang.
umur yang merupakan hasil kalkulasi antara Tgl Lahir dan tanggal hari
3. Relationship
Relationship merupakan hubungan yang terjadi antara satu entitas atau lebih.
b. Partial participation
penghubung.
4. Indicator Type
Indicator tipe asosiatif object berfungsi sebagai suatu objek dan suatu
relationship.
57
Contoh :
Indicator tipe super tipe, terdiri dari suatu object dan satu subkategori
bernama.
Contoh :
Yang berarti setiap entitas pad himpunan entitas A berhubungan dengan paling
banyak dengan satu entitas pada himpunan entitas B, dan begitu sebaliknya
58
Contoh :
Pada relasi ini, setiap dosen paling banyak mengepali satu jurusan (walaupun
memang tidak semua dosen yang menjadi ketua jurusan). Dan setiap jurusan
dengan paling banyak dengan satu entitas pada himpunan entitas B, tetapi tidak
Contoh :
59
Pada relasi ini, setiap dosen dapat mengajar lebih dari satu
orang dosen.